项目组件化之遇到的坑 发表于 2016-10-10 | 分类于 实践 | 在MDCC中冯森林老师的组件化思路,为我们这些没有那么多精力折腾黑科技开发者们打开了另一扇门。 需要做的事情很简单,就是将业务解耦模块化,让这个模块在debug下作为application单独运行,而在release下就作为library。 这篇其实只是写一下我碰到的问题,记录一下。 组件化套壳思路 ... 阅读全文 »
Java->Android并发编程筑基篇 发表于 2016-09-07 | 分类于 实践 | 最近有点忙,又有其他的事情,所以一直没有开始写这篇,感觉很惭愧。 上一章讲了太多的东西,其实每一个小细节都可以写成一长篇,这一章会尽量用精简的方式把坑填上。 Java的线程状态想要学好并发,还是得知道线程的生命周期,先看一下线程的生命周期: 在线程的运行周期中会有状态与锁有关,所以先要讲解线程的状 ... 阅读全文 »
Java->Android并发编程引气入门篇 发表于 2016-08-13 | 分类于 实践 | Android的并发编程,即多线程开发,而Android的多线程开发模型也是源于Java中的多线程模型。所以本篇也会先讲一些Java中的多线程理念,再讲解具体涉及的类,最后深入Android中的并发场景和实践。 并发什么是并发举个很简单的栗子,当你一边在撸撸撸,一边在看小视频,同时在做两件事,这就是 ... 阅读全文 »
从什么都不懂开始(五)——做了这些事,今天就别干活了 发表于 2016-07-29 | 分类于 实践 | 前面四篇已经讲述了如何开始使用Git以及Git的命令操作。作者作为一名作死小能手,在Git上也曾花样作死过,本节将介绍一些作死Tips 作死篇大小写问题创建文件的时候,手贱写了小写的首字母,然后rename了文件后,发现git status里还是原来的名字! 因为git是大小写不敏感的,如果想要大小 ... 阅读全文 »
从什么都不懂开始(四)——Git掌握时空之力 发表于 2016-07-22 | 分类于 实践 | 看到这篇标题是不是有种很叼的感觉!?在Git的工作流程中,不仅能往前走,当然也可以后退。不仅能提交文件,当然也能删除或者修改了。而且你想回到哪个提交节点就回到哪个提交节点,是不是觉得自己体内的洪荒之力快抑制不住了? 别急,容我短话长说,一一道来。 在这真正讲这些也需要普及一个概念:工作区和暂存区 工 ... 阅读全文 »